Product Description

Stylish colourways and a semi-plain statement, the Zen rug uses texture and relaxing hues to create a calm oasis in your living space. Hand-crafted by skilled rug artisans, the Zen rug is composed of 100% wool to embrace natural warmth and sound insulating qualities, to create a cosy, quiet oasis for modern living. This rug is ideal for adding texture to contemporary living and dining rooms.Don't forget to buy our handy anti-slip mat,[here,](https://www.dunelm.com/product/rug-anti-slip-mat-1000002949?defaultSkuId=30132247) available in a range of sizes.This is a dense hand-made rug. When opening, re-roll your rug pile out and leave in a warm room for 24 hours before putting in place, this will help to reduce wrinkles and curling from packing. Do not pull any loose threads, please cut them carefully with scissors to remove. Avoid prolonged exposure to direct sunlight as this may cause fading of the colour. Turn your rug regularly to ensure even wear and to reduce pressure marks from furniture. Wool fibres may shed when new and during use, this is a characteristic of this product and is not a defect and should reduce with normal use and regular vacuuming.Before using any cleaning products on your rug, test on an inconspicuous area first to ensure it does not affect the colour. Clean spills immediately by blotting with a clean dry white cloth - do not rub as this may stain the fibres. Vacuum your rug regularly to remove everyday dirt, we recommend the use of a suction type vacuum cleaner as a rotating vacuum brush can cause damage to the pile surface.We recommend the use of an anti-slip mat beneath your rug to prevent it from slipping and sliding out of place.Latex is used on the back of this rug. Please do not leave babies or young children unsupervised on this rug.
